'Certaine notes gathered owt of the Recordes remaining in the Treasaurye, thexchequyre, the Towre, and the Kinges Benche, towching the kinges majestes title to the Souereyntie ... of the realme of Scotlande ...', preceded by an index, and followed by some Latin notes on the same subject. On fols. 46-7 are some Latin notes on the position of Cæsarea Lutrea (Kaiserslautern in Bavaria).
